Akademik Birim: |
|
Öğrenim Türü: |
Örgün eğitim |
Ön Koşullar |
Yok |
Öğrenim Dili: |
Türkçe |
Dersin Düzeyi: |
Önlisans |
Dersin Koordinatörü: |
Murat BAŞKAN |
Dersin Amacı: |
Mikrodenetleyici tabanlı sistem geliştirmek için gerekli tüm işlemler |
Dersin İçeriği: |
Bir problemin çözümüne yönelik olarak bir mikrodenetleyici seçmek ve gerekli algoritmayı oluşturarak mikrodenetleyici ile gömülü sistem oluşturulmasını kavramak |
Dersin Öğrenme Çıktıları (ÖÇ): |
- 1- Mikrodenetleyici temel yapı mimarisini tanıyarak yapılacak iş için en uygun işlemcinin seçimini yapmak,
- 2- Algoritma oluşturarak buradan programlama diline geçiş yapabilmek,
- 3- Derlenmiş olan programı mikrodenetleyiciye yüklemek
|
Dersin Öğrenme Yöntem ve Teknikleri |
Bilgisayar, Projeksiyon, anlatım, PIC 16F877A mikrodenetleyici deney seti üzerinde uygulama yapma. |
Hafta | Konular | Ön Hazırlık |
1 |
Mikroişlemci ve mikrodenetleyici genel özellikleri |
|
2 |
PIC16F877`nin donanım özellikleri |
|
3 |
PIC assembly programı ve PIC programlamaya giriş |
|
4 |
Akış diyagramları ve assembly program yapıları |
|
5 |
Veri transferi ve karar işlemleri |
|
6 |
Döngü düzenlemek |
|
7 |
Zaman geciktirme ve alt programlar |
|
8 |
Buton kullanımı ve veri girişi örnekleri |
|
9 |
Makro yapısı ve özellikleri |
|
10 |
Bit kaydırma ve mantıksal işlem komutları |
|
11 |
Çevrim tabloları ve uygulamaları |
|
12 |
Kesmeler, kesme kaynakları kullanımı, zamanlayıcılar, |
|
13 |
Kesme örnekleri, sayıcılar ve kullanımı |
|
14 |
Analog dijital çevirici uygulamaları |
|
Kadir Has Üniversitesi'nde bir dönem 14 haftadır, 15. ve 16. hafta sınav haftalarıdır.